Health Tip: Banishing Bad Study Habits
By LadyLively on September 24, 2019
Making a habit out of all-nighters or cramming can be unhealthy and lead to poor scholastic performance, says the American Psychological Association.
To banish bad study habits, the group suggests:
- Create a new habit in 60 days.
- Embrace a routine.
- Find a way to enjoy your work.
- Take breaks.
- Develop realistic goals.
- Turn off your smartphone during study time.
